Hi,
I've just been looking at my reports and was getting a bit confused when entering my dates, as they weren't coming up as expected.
e.g. See the top date i've entered, thinking it was dd/mm/yyyy, but all the results show as mm/dd/yyyy. 


Is there a setting i'm missing, or is this a bug?
I would expect it to be one or the other, not both?

The only way we've been able to replicate this if the browser locale is mismatched to the operating system. Is Chrome set to English or GB-EN to match the OS?

Yeah, see if there's an option for "English - UK" or something similar. It looks to me like Chrome is set to English (US), but your OS is set to English - GB. That may be the issue.
